A PAIR OF GLAZED CERAMIC BUDDHIST LIONS
Japan, 19th century
Both seated on their hind legs, their heads accentuatedly bent, their mouths open to show the sharp teeth, the profile of the mouth and the eyes painted in yellow and red, the outside covered with a white glaze.
33 cm high each
Provenance: Italian private collection.
A pair of Buddhist lions quite similar to this one can be found in the Musée d'Ennery in Paris.
